Understanding the Moscow Terrorist Attack

On March 22, 2024, a devastating terrorist attack shook the heart of Moscow, leaving a trail of destruction and loss. A group of at least five gunmen, armed with automatic weapons and clad in camouflage, launched a brutal assault on a bustling concert hall on the city’s western outskirts (Moscow Concert Hall Massacre). The venue, Crocus City Hall, was hosting a performance by the renowned Russian rock band Picnic, drawing a sizable crowd of music enthusiasts.

The assailants struck with ferocity, indiscriminately firing into the unsuspecting crowd and detonating explosives, setting the concert hall ablaze (Moscow Concert Hall Massacre). The chaos and panic that ensued led to the tragic loss of over 60 lives, with more than 100 individuals sustaining injuries, some critically. The scene was one of horror and devastation, as flames engulfed the venue and its roof collapsed under the onslaught.

The Aftermath: Unraveling Responsibility

In the aftermath of the horrific attack, questions swirled about the perpetrators and their motives. Soon after the incident, the Islamic State (ISIS-Khorasan) claimed responsibility for the atrocity, asserting that their fighters had launched the assault on the outskirts of Moscow, inflicting casualties and causing extensive damage before retreating unharmed.

This claim by ISIS-Khorasan added another layer of complexity to the already tense geopolitical landscape, particularly against the backdrop of Russia’s ongoing conflict in Ukraine (Moscow Concert Hall Massacre). Global Condemnation and Solidarity

In the wake of the Moscow terrorist attack, leaders from around the world voiced their condemnation and solidarity with the Russian people. United Nations Secretary-General Antonio Guterres condemned the attack in the strongest terms possible, labeling it a “heinous and cowardly terrorist act.” French President Emmanuel Macron, along with leaders from Spain and Italy, expressed solidarity with the victims and their families, denouncing the attack as an affront to peace and stability.

Prime Minister Narendra Modi of India also joined the chorus of condemnation, branding the attack as a “heinous act of terrorism” and pledging unwavering support to the Russian government and its people. The Identity of the Perpetrators: ISIS-Khorasan

The terrorist organization behind the Moscow bombing, ISIS-Khorasan, traces its origins to eastern Afghanistan, where it emerged in late 2014 (Moscow Concert Hall Massacre). Despite facing setbacks and declining membership in recent years, ISIS-Khorasan remains a potent threat, known for its extreme brutality and willingness to inflict mass casualties.

The group’s claim of responsibility for the Crocus City Hall attack further highlights its intent to sow chaos and terror on a global scale. From deadly bombings in Iran to attacks on Kabul’s international airport, ISIS-Khorasan has demonstrated its capacity for violence and destruction, posing a significant challenge to regional and international security efforts.
